     In addition to being a poet, the author is also a sculptor and a visual artist. The front and back cover art was created by him as clay monoprints. Clay monoprints are created by inlaying clay slip into a clay slab, through a variety of techniques. Controlling moisture and pressure, the image is then printed onto a material called Reemay. The results are very bright colorful monoprints that many people initially mistake for oil paintings.
